Kathryn Harrold (born August 2, 1950) is an American former actress, best known for starring in Albert Brooks’ Modern Romance and John Landis’ Into the Night. After retiring from acting in 2011, Harrold retrained as a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ist (LMFT) and now runs her own counseling practice in Los Angeles, California.
